    Responsibilities:
    Responsible and accountable for leading the budgeting, forecasting, long-term planning, and strategic analysis for the business.

    Responsible for developing and driving a proactive, collaborative partnership between functions across the organization, understanding Finance & Analytics team needs (at Corporate and the Regions), driving constructive and engaging conversations, monitoring stakeholder feedback, and identifying trends and opportunities to advance the Companys overall business and financial strategy.

    Lead the Companys budgeting and forecasting process, including quantitative analysis around the Companys key business drivers.
    Manage the FP&A calendar (close, forecast, reporting, budget), coordinating with key stakeholders.
    Work closely with Corporate Controller in preparation for stakeholder reporting and MD&A (for lenders and sponsors)
    Lead and coordinate ad hoc requests from company leadership.
    Create effective performance metrics (KPIs) that can be regularly tracked to measure progress and drive accountability throughout the organization.

    Drive profitable growth by improving visibility, forecasting, consolidation and analysis of results and key metrics while advising senior management on insights and recommended actions.

    Develop partnership with stakeholders throughout organization and drive cross-functional alignment on finance processes and planning.
    Maintain up-to-date technical knowledge, market conditions, and trends. Assess economic and Hilb specific business drivers and their corresponding impact.
    Drive the continuous improvement of FP&A processes, methodologies, and tools to enhance accuracy, efficiency, and effectiveness.
    Recruit, develop, and mentor a high-performing team of FP&A professionals, fostering a culture of collaboration, accountability, and continuous learning.

    Qualifications:
    Bachelors degree in finance, Accounting, Business Administration, or related field; MBA or advanced degree preferred.

    Minimum 7 years of experience within the Finance function or with relevant experience in strategy/management consulting, or corporate finance with at least 3 years managing FP&A.

    Proficiency in financial modeling, forecasting, budgeting, and analysis tools; experience with enterprise performance management (EPM) systems and financial software is desirable.

    Strong financial acumen and analytical skills, with the ability to interpret complex financial data, perform quantitative analysis, and develop actionable insights.

    Excellent communication, presentation, and interpersonal skills, with the ability to effectively engage and influence stakeholders at all levels of the organization.

    Proven leadership experience, including the ability to inspire and motivate teams, drive results, and foster a culture of excellence and continuous improvement.

    Strong project management skills and demonstrated ability to lead complex cross-functional initiatives across a breadth of stakeholders.

    Insurance experience is a plus, with a preference for working knowledge of direct bill, agency bill, personal lines, commercial lines, employee benefits, and specialty insurance.

    Team oriented, collaborative, diplomatic, and flexible, with excellent presentation skills.
    Demonstrated ability to thrive in a dynamic and fast-paced environment with the ability to think strategically.
